to sell somebody down the river
01

to be unfaithful or disloyal to someone so as to gain profit oneself

I ca n't believe my business partner sold me down the river by stealing company funds and disappearing.
He promised to support our cause, but he ended up selling us down the river by revealing our plans to our opponents.
